Publisher's Summary
A comprehensive value-investing framework for the individual investor.
In a straightforward and accessible manner, The Dhandho Investor lays out the powerful framework of value investing. Written with the intelligent individual investor in mind, this comprehensive guide distills the Dhandho capital allocation framework of the business-savvy Patels from India and presents how they can be applied successfully to the stock market. The Dhandho method expands on the groundbreaking principles of value investing expounded by Benjamin Graham, Warren Buffett, and Charlie Munger.
Listeners will be introduced to important value investing concepts such as "Heads, I win! Tails, I don't lose that much!", "Few Bets, Big Bets, Infrequent Bets", Abhimanyu's dilemma, and a detailed treatise on using the Kelly Formula to invest in undervalued stocks.
Using a light, entertaining style, Pabrai lays out the Dhandho framework in an easy-to-use format. Any investor who adopts the framework is bound to improve on results and soundly beat the markets and most professionals.

Timeless Investment Strategies and Stories
I really enjoyed the book, lots of great stories. Talks about how investors should think, and real-life stories to make you remember these principles. Easy to understand, it changes my mindset on the bet size and my perspective on risks and rewards. Definitely a good read.
One part I find hard to follow is the numbers and figures it uses to prove a principle. If you are reading a book, that's easier to follow. But listening to the audible makes it hard to memorize all the numbers and figures.
Just a heads up, that the Kelly formula mentioned is not updated. As Mohnish Pabrai himself said in his lectures. The Kelly formula is only for frequent betting, so it is not applicable to stock investments. He said it himself, he would take that out of the book if he is writing it again.
